TRU/USDT recent trend is worth analyzing. From a technical perspective, the 1-hour chart shows signs of a mild rebound, but the 4-hour RSI is already overbought, and at the same time, trading volume has significantly decreased. This kind of shrinking volume rebound is quite subtle—appearing to have momentum for a rebound, but its sustainability is questionable, more like searching for a new balance point between the two forces.
The price has fallen from a high level to the current consolidation zone, and the market is waiting for clearer bullish or bearish signals. At this stage, patience is more important than rushing to trade. Based on current support and resistance levels, if the price can stabilize around 0.0095 and be confirmed, then consider a light long position; but if there is a volume-driven decline and it breaks below the key level of 0.009, the short-term structure will weaken, and risk needs to be reassessed.
